How To Eat More High Volume Vegetables (Nigerian Food Friendly)



Tip 1: Recognise them


What are high volume vegetables?

High volume vegetables contain high amounts of fibre and water.


They take up a large amount of space (volume) in your stomach helping you feel full(er) for longer.

Image from www.rudymawer.com showing how 500cals of different food groups take up space in one's stomach.

Examples include Spinach, Broccoli, Cucumber, Peppers, Okra & Cauliflower.


Tip 2: Have them on the side or mix in with your main dish

Example: Rice, Chicken & Efo Riro (Spinach Stew)
Example: Fried rice with mixed vegetables


Tip 3: Enjoy them as a snack

Example: Cucumber sticks enjoyed with/ without a dip

Tip 4: Put them in a salad

Example: Leafy Green Salad topped with Cherry Tomatoes

Tip 5: Soup It Up!


Example: Carrot & Pumpkin Soup
(Can be consumed on its own or with a swallow/solid, e.g. amala, pounded yam, eba.  Recommended swallow size: 100g dry weight.)
Example: Seafood Okra soup
